CVE-2022-31069

OAuth token disclosure via unconditional header forwarding

Published Jun 15, 2022 · Updated Apr 23, 2025

Sensitive information exposure in Finastra nestjs-proxy before 0.7.0 allows attackers to expose OAuth bearer tokens to backend services. The proxy forwards each incoming Authorization header to the selected configured service without a per-service suppression control. The gate is an authenticated request routed through such a service, and the direct consequence is disclosure of its bearer token to that backend.
